A straight-four engine (also called an inline-four) is a four-cylinder piston engine where cylinders are arranged in a line along a common crankshaft. WebThe first single-cylinder GSX-R motorcycle, the 125 cc (7.6 cu in) GSX-R125 was introduced at the 2016 Intermot. The stroked-up 147.3 cc (8.99 cu in) GSX-R150 was officially unveiled in Indonesia at the 2016 Indonesia Motorcycle Show.
